    The main advantages of the equipment are:

    It effectively separates algae, fine suspended solids and microaggregates out of water.

    It extracts useful substances from industrial wastewater, such as paper pulp and fillers in a paper manufacturing process, replacing secondary settling tanks for sediment separation and concentration. It is particularly suitable for biochemical treatment processes with a tendency to sediment formation, allowing to separate and recover suspended and emulsified oil from oily wastewater, as well as to remove or recover substances in ionic state, such as surface-active materials and metal ions.

    How does vortex flotation differ from traditional compressor-based systems?

    In a CAF (Cavity Air Flotation) system, microbubbles are created by a special impeller-aerator that draws air in through vacuum. This eliminates the need for expensive compressors, saturators, and recirculation pumps. The system consumes less energy and is easier to maintain, while remaining highly effective at removing grease and oil products.
